April 27

In 1993, Wayne Gretzky scored a goal and added three assists to lead the Kings to a 9-4 playoff win at Calgary in Game 5 of the Smythe Divison Semi-Finals.

April 26

In 1999, just seven days after his final game, the Hockey Hall of Fame waives the three year waiting period to induct Gretzky into the Hall of Fame.

April 25

In 1985, Wayne Gretzky scored a hat trick and added 4 assists to lead the Oilers to an 8-3 win over the Winnipeg Jets, in Game Four of the Smythe Division Finals in Edmonton as the Oilers swept the series.

April 24

In 1983, Wayne Gretzky tied an NHL record with three assists in one period (the third), and added the game winning goal as the Oilers beat Chicago 8-4, in Game 1 of their Campbell Conference Finals.

****

In 1984, Edmonton's Wayne Gretzky scored a goal and added three assists as the Oilers won 7-1 over the visiting Minnesota North Stars, in Game 1 of the Campbell Conference Finals.

****

In 1986, Edmonton's Wayne Gretzky scored a hat trick and added two assists as the Oilers won 7-4 at Calgary, in Game 4 of the Smythe Division Finals.

****

In 1989, the Kings' Wayne Gretzky scored his 86th career playoff goal, making him the #1 playoff goal scorer in NHL history (passing Mike Bossy who had 85 with the Islanders). Kings lost 5-3 to Flames, in Game 4 of the Smythe Division Finals.

April 23

In 1996, Wayne Gretzky picked up three assists as St. Louis won 5-1 over the visiting Toronto Maple Leafs to give the Blues a 3-1 lead in their Western Conference Quarter-Final series.

****

In 1997, Wayne Gretzky scored a natural hat trick (his league-record 9th playoff hat trick) within a span of 6:23 during the second period, as the Rangers won 3-2 over the visting Panthers, in Game 4 of the Eastern Conference Quarter-Finals.

April 21

In 1988, Edmonton's Wayne Gretzky scored a shorthanded goal at 7:54 of overtime to give the Oilers a 5-4 win at Calgary, in Game Two of the Smythe Division Finals. It was just the third shorthanded OT winner in Stanley Cup history.

April 20

In 1992, the Kings' Wayne Gretzky picked up four assists to become the first player in NHL history to record 300 career playoff points, in an 8-5 win over the Oilers, in Game 2 of the Smythe Division Semi-Finals, in Los Angeles.

April 19

In 1981, Edmonton's Wayne Gretzky scored a hat trick in a 5-2 playoff win over the Islanders, in Game Three of the Quarter-Finals in Edmonton.

April 18

In 1999, Wayne Gretzky got his final point (2,847) of his NHL career on an assist when the Rangers lost 2-1 in overtime against the visiting Pittsburgh Penguins, in the final game of his career with the New York Rangers. On his retirement from the NHL, Gretzky held forty regular-season records, fifteen playoff records, and six NHL All-Star records.

April 17

In 1983, Edmonton's Wayne Gretzky set a playoff record for most points in a game, with seven (on four goals and three assists) in a 10-2 win at Calgary.

****

1995, the Los Angeles Kings Wayne Gretzky picked up an assist to become the first 2,500 career point scorer in NHL history, as Los Angeles lost 5-2, at Calgary.

April 16

In 1996, Wayne Gretzky picked up three assists when St. Louis won 3-1, at Toronto in Game 1 of the Western Conference Quarter-Finals.

April 15

In 1969, Wayne received his first trophy at age seven. The Wally Bauer Trophy was awarded to the Most Improved Novice All-Star.

April 12

In 1986, Wayne Gretzky picked up career playoff assists #102 and #103 to pass Islanders' Denis Potvin and move into first place on the all time NHL playoff assist list. Oilers won 5-1 at Vancouver, in Game 3 of the Smythe Division Semi-Finals.

****
In 1987, Edmonton's Wayne Gretzky scored a goal and added four assists to lead the Oilers to a 6-3 win over the Kings, in Game 4 of the Smythe Division Semi-Finals, in Los Angeles. His goal and three assists in the third period set a record for most points in a period during a playoff game.

****
In 1988, Edmonton's Wayne Gretzky scored a goal and added four assists as the Oilers won 6-2 against the visiting Winnipeg Jets, in Game 5 of the Smythe Division Semi-Finals.

****

In 1991, Wayne Gretzky had four assists to give him 200 in his playoff career. His milestone came as the Kings beat Vancouver 7-4, in Game 5 of the Smythe Division Semi-Finals.

April 11

In 1981, Edmonton's Wayne Gretzky scored the first hat trick in Oilers' playoff history, and added an assist as the Oilers won 6-2 over the visiting Montreal Canadiens, in Game 3 of the Preliminary Round.

April 10

In 1991, Wayne Gretzky scored his 93rd career playoff goal -- the most in NHL history -- to lead the Kings to a 6-1 win at Vancouver, in Game 4 of the Smythe Division Semi-Finals. Gretzky passed Jari Kurri, who had scored 92 career playoff goals.

April 9

In 1987, Wayne Gretzky had six assists for the Oilers, tying the NHL record for most assists in a playoff game as the Edmonton Oilers set a Stanley Cup playoff record for most goals in a game when they beat L.A. 13-3 in game two of the Smythe Division Semi-Finals.

****

Gretzky's six assists also included his 177th career playoff point, passing Jean Beliveau and putting him into first place on the all time playoff scoring list.

****

Gretzky also scored a goal in the Oilers 13-3 win to give him seven points in a playoff game for the third time in his career.

April 8

In 1981, Edmonton's Wayne Gretzky picked up five assists as the Oilers won 6-3 at Montreal, in Game 1 of the Stanley Cup Preliminary Round.

April 6

In 1983, Edmonton's Wayne Gretzky scored four goals and added an assist as the Oilers won 6-3 over the visiting Winnipeg Jets, in Game 1 of the Smythe Division Semi-Finals. Gretzky tied a playoff record with two shorthanded goals.

****

In 1991, Wayne Gretzky scored at 11:08 of overtime to give the Kings a 3-2 win over Vancouver, in Game Two of the Smythe Division Semi-Finals at the Forum.

****

In 1994, Wayne Gretzky was presented with the Lester Patrick Award at a luncheon in Los Angeles, for "outstanding service to the game of hockey in the United States".

April 4

In 1981, Playing in his 159th career game, Wayne Gretzky scored a goal and added four assists, to give him 300 career NHL points. The milestone came in a 7-2 Oilers' win over the Winnipeg Jets in Edmonton.

****

In 1986, Edmonton's Wayne Gretzky had three assists to give him 214 points and broke his single-season record (212 points set in 1981-82) in a 9-3 Oilers' loss at Calgary.

April 3

In 1997, Wayne Gretzky notched his 2,700th career NHL point with a goal in the Rangers' 5-4 win over Boston. The point gave Gretzy a lead of 850 points over Gordie Howe in NHL career scoring.

April 2

In 1980, Edmonton rookie Wayne Gretzky became the first teenager to score 50 goals in a season, when the 19-year-old first year NHL player scored for the Oilers in a 1-1 tie against the Minnesota North Stars, at Northlands Coliseum.

April 1

In 1981, Wayne Gretzky broke Bobby Orr's single season record for assists, with his 103rd and 104th of the season, in a 4-4 Oilers' tie against the Colorado Rockies.
